Strategic Number Selection Approaches
While all numbers in a lottery draw are theoretically equally likely to be selected, some players employ strategies to choose their numbers. One common approach is to avoid commonly picked numbers, such as birthdays or sequences (1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6). If these numbers are drawn, the jackpot is likely to be split among many winners, significantly reducing individual payouts. Conversely, selecting less common combinations might mean you’re the sole winner if those numbers are drawn, leading to a larger personal return.
Another strategy involves analyzing past winning numbers, although it’s vital to remember that lotteries are independent events. Past results do not influence future outcomes. However, some players use this data to identify “hot” or “cold” numbers as a psychological aid for selection. More practically, some players utilize random number generators or “quick picks” to ensure a truly random selection, removing personal bias entirely and potentially generating combinations that might not occur to a human player.
The Role of Syndicate Play
Joining or forming a lottery syndicate is a popular tactic to increase your chances of winning without drastically increasing individual cost. A syndicate involves a group of people pooling their money to buy a larger number of tickets. This collective buying power means the group has more entries in the draw, thereby improving the overall probability of holding a winning ticket for the group. The cost per individual is significantly lower than buying the same number of tickets alone.
While syndicates enhance winning chances, it’s crucial to have clear agreements in place regarding ticket purchases, number selection, and prize distribution. A well-managed syndicate ensures fairness and transparency, preventing disputes. When a syndicate wins, the prize money is shared amongst all members according to their agreed-upon stakes. This collaborative approach to gambling can make playing the lottery more engaging and potentially more rewarding, as the group benefits from the increased coverage of number combinations.
Managing Your Gambling Budget Wisely
Effective budget management is paramount for any form of gambling, including lotteries. It’s vital to set a strict budget for lottery ticket purchases and adhere to it religiously. Treat lottery spending as entertainment expense rather than an investment. Only spend disposable income that you can afford to lose without impacting your financial stability. This discipline ensures that the pursuit of potential returns doesn’t lead to detrimental financial consequences.
Responsible gambling also means understanding when to stop. If you find yourself consistently chasing losses or spending more than you initially intended, it’s a sign to take a break. Many platforms, including online casinos that offer lottery-style games, provide tools for setting deposit limits, session time limits, and self-exclusion periods. Utilizing these features can help maintain control and ensure that your lottery participation remains a fun and manageable activity, contributing to a positive gambling experience overall.
